If they combined all realms, and use Warmode to separate PVP from non PVP layers, that would be kind of cool. In Retail, since they have separate talents that activate during PVP, having warmode on allows for the added benefit of being able to use those talents all the time.

There are a lot of solutions to Classic problems that exist in Retail, but they aren’t so simple or atomic, but have several dependencies that make them viable.

In my case, this became a lot more apparent after having played through Classic content and returning to Retail. That’s yet another reason why I’d prefer to have Classic progression be as true to the original as possible, as it sheds great light on why and how things evolved the way they have for Retail.
